Budget Committee

Committee members around the table

Oregon Revised Statute (ORS) 294.414 delineates the requirements of municipal budget committees and that the committees shall be established in accordance with that section. 

“The budget committee shall consist of the members of the governing body and a number, equal to the number of members of the governing body, of electors of the municipal corporation appointed by the governing body; if there are electors fewer than the number required, the governing body and the electors who are willing to serve shall be the budget committee; and if there are no electors willing to serve, the governing body shall be the budget committee.”

By statute, the Budget Committee cannot be compensated nor may they be officers, agents, or employees of the municipality. 

The essence of the Budget Committee is to serve as the citizen’s representative in developing the annual budget. While the Committee cannot usurp the City Council’s authority in setting City programs, policies, services, and resources, it does provide valuable oversight of the process. And as such, the Committee receives the City Manager’s proposed budget and recommends an “approved budget” to the City Council for adoption.

 

 

The Budget Committee also serves at the Carlton Urban Renewal Agency  Budget Committee.
